Peter M. Vacchino Obituary

Peter Vacchino of Kingston, MA passed away peacefully on Saturday, September 6, 2025, surrounded by his family, after a long illness. He is survived by his children Kara Swisher (Chris), Lynsey Canney-Vacchino (Danielle), Mark Vacchino, and their mother Beth Vacchino. Additionally, his grandchildren Cecelia and Oliver Swisher, who brought him so much joy. He is also survived by his longtime girlfriend Laurie Hulbig, brother Tom Vacchino (Nancy), sister Cindy Vacchino, nephew Tim Vacchino (Elinor) and sister Margot Peters.


Peter was born in Plymouth, the son of Fred and Betty Vacchino and was raised in a tight knit neighborhood near Nelson beach. Summers were spent with his family creating lasting memories at Widgeon Pond. At 18 he joined the Navy during the Vietnam War, proudly serving on the USS Yorktown. After his return, he met Beth Whiteley, and together they built a family in Kingston. Peter made his career at Verizon for over 40 years, where he loved the challenge of solving a complicated technical issue and was proud of being known as “the fix it guy.” In retirement, he enjoyed tending to his house and yard, jamming in the living room on his guitar, and spending time with his family. Family was extremely important to him, which expanded to include Laurie’s children and grandchildren. He and Laurie enjoyed going on adventures and dancing on the weekends.


Peter loved the outdoors, whether working in his yard, skiing with his friends in the ski group “The Flying Turkeys”, or just swinging in his hammock with his dog by his side. He was always quick to help anyone who needed a hand, had a great sense of humor and was never shy about striking up a conversation with anyone willing to listen. 


Peter’s kindness, generosity, and quick wit will be deeply missed, but his spirit will live on in the family he was so proud of, and the memories he helped create.


The family would like to thank everyone at the Newfield House for the love and care they showed to Peter during his time there.
